Random number mechanisms and impartiality
Random number mechanisms represent the central mechanism guaranteeing unpredictable outcomes in virtual wagering. These algorithms yield patterns of numbers that establish game outcomes, from slot reel positions to card deals. Casino on-line platforms rely on approved random number mechanisms to preserve equity and block interference of gaming outcomes.

Anti-fraud mechanisms observe payment behaviors to detect dubious behaviors. Machine learning formulas evaluate payment intervals, cashout totals, and geographic places to highlight possibly illegitimate transactions. Danger analysis systems allocate points to payments, initiating human inspections when limits are breached.

Developing breakthroughs in digital gambling platforms
Artificial intelligence enables tailored advisory mechanisms that offer titles grounded on player preferences and historical habits. Machine learning systems analyze activity habits to forecast titles that unique users might enjoy. Automated assistants provide prompt player support, responding to common requests and addressing system difficulties without personal intervention accessible through Netbet support options.
Blockchain-based verifiably fair wagering enables participants to validate result authenticity independently. Encryption methods empower players to validate that outcomes were determined equitably without provider interference.
